City Of Santa Rosa Appoints New City Clerk

New Santa Rosa City Clerk Stephanie Williams most recently served as Healdsburg city clerk.

SANTA ROSA, CA — Stephanie Williams has been appointed as Santa Rosa's new city clerk, City Manager Sean McGlynn said Tuesday.

Williams has 27 years of experience in municipal government and most recently was the City Clerk of Healdsburg. She formerly was deputy city clerk of Santa Rosa where she helped the city transition to a new, modernized online legislative record management system, McGlynn said.

Williams, a Santa Rosa resident for 40 years, starts the job on Jan. 27.
